The UK has issued the Double Taxation Relief and International Tax Enforcement (Belarus) (Revocation) Order 2025, which was made on 12 March 2025, revoking the 2018 Order that had implemented the 2017 tax treaty with Belarus.
As a result, the treaty will be suspended from 6 April 2025 for income tax and capital gains tax and from 1 April 2025 for corporation tax and other taxes.
Earlier, The UK HMRC announced, on 4 February 2025, that the 2017 tax treaty with Belarus will be suspended on 6 April 2025, for income tax and capital gains tax, and on 1 April 2025, for corporation tax and other taxes.
